New sustainability strategy from Greencore
British convenience foods manufacturer Greencore has introduced a new sustainability strategy that includes a range of pledges in the areas of sourcing, manufacturing and community engagement. The company has pledged to make all of the group’s packaging recyclable or reusable by 2025, cut food waste by 50 percent by 2030 and achieve net-zero emissions by 2040.
